AngioDynamics(ANGO) - 2026 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-04-02 13: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ue increased by 8.9% to $78.4 million, driven by growth in both MedTech and Med Device segments [13] - Adjusted EBITDA improved to $1.8 million from $1.3 million year-over-year, attributed to MedTech revenue growth and operational efficiency [18] - Gross margin for Q3 FY 2026 was 52.9%, a decrease of 110 basis points from the previous year, primarily due to tariffs and inflation [16]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- MedTech revenue reached $37.3 million, a 19% increase, comprising 48% of total revenue compared to 44% a year ago [13] - Auryon platform generated $16.3 million in revenue, growing 17.9% year-over-year, marking 19 consecutive quarters of double-digit growth [13][14] - Mechanical thrombectomy revenue, including AngioVac and AlphaVac, increased by 17.9% to $11.5 million, with AlphaVac revenue growing 47.4% year-over-year [14]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The Med Device segment saw a modest increase of 1.1% year-over-year, with a year-to-date growth of 3% [15] - NanoKnife revenue increased by 21% to $7.6 million, driven by strong demand in prostate care and capital sales [15]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on driving profitable growth in high-margin MedTech markets, with a strategic shift towards hospital settings [5][41] - Continued investment in R&D is planned, targeting approximately 10% of sales to support long-term growth [17] - The company is raising its full-year guidance for net sales and adjusted EBITDA for the third consecutive quarter, reflecting confidence in its growth strategy [21]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the resilience of the business despite macroeconomic challenges, including tariffs and inflation [5][19] - The company anticipates continued growth in the AlphaVac product line and expects to maintain strong performance in the MedTech segment [30][38] Other Important Information - The company plans to increase inventory levels in anticipation of temporary sterilization shutdowns, which may slightly impact cash flow [23][50] - The leadership transition process is underway, with a search committee formed to find a successor for the current CEO [24] Q&A Session Summary Question: AlphaVac sequential growth drivers and impact of PE guidelines - Management noted that growth is driven by new hospital approvals and physician comfort with the product, expecting continued sequential growth [29][30] Question: Guidance impact from higher energy costs and supplier costs - Management confirmed that guidance accounts for inflationary pressures and tariffs, with some ability to raise prices on superior products [32][33] Question: Future baseline for AlphaVac revenue - Management expects AlphaVac to continue growing sequentially, viewing current revenue as a strong driver for future growth [38] Question: Auryon volume versus price dynamics - Management highlighted the strategic shift towards hospital settings, which supports pricing and volume growth, and expects Auryon to continue growing [40][41] Question: Supply chain exposure to China and sterilization shutdowns - Management indicated minimal risk from China sourcing and noted that sterilization shutdowns are not frequent, with plans in place to mitigate any disruptions [48][50]

AngioDynamics (NasdaqGS:ANGO) 2026 Conference Transcript
2026-03-09 18:42
Summary of AngioDynamics 2026 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: AngioDynamics (NasdaqGS: ANGO) - **Industry**: Medical Technology - **CEO**: Jim Clemmer - **Conference Date**: March 09, 2026 Key Points Business Evolution and Strategy - AngioDynamics has transformed from a traditional medical device company to a technology-focused entity over the past five years, targeting larger and faster-growing markets where patient outcomes are measurable [8][9] - The company has divested from slower, commodity-based markets and invested in three key areas: cardiovascular platforms and interventional oncology [9] - Simplification of the supply chain has been implemented to reduce unnecessary costs and ensure a clear pathway for future growth [9][10] Financial Performance - The company operates on a unique fiscal year starting June 1, with the most recent quarter ending February 28, 2026 [13] - The Med Device segment, while historically less profitable, has generated cash to support the transformation, while the Med Tech segment has shown nearly 20% growth in the first six months of the fiscal year [14][15] - Gross margins and overall profits have exceeded expectations, leading to an upward revision of guidance after the second quarter [15] Med Tech Segment Insights - The Med Tech segment includes two cardiovascular areas: arterial disease and venous disease, along with interventional oncology using the NanoKnife technology [19] - The Auryon system, launched over five years ago, has generated over $60 million in revenue this year, showcasing strong growth against established competitors [22] - The company has achieved 18 consecutive quarters of double-digit growth, with over 40% of revenue now coming from hospitals [24] Competitive Landscape - The mechanical thrombectomy market is currently 15%-20% penetrated, with AngioDynamics competing against Inari and Penumbra [40] - The AngioVac product is positioned as a high-end catheter-based device, while the newly developed AlphaVac aims to capture the pulmonary embolism (PE) market [42][44] - AlphaVac is expected to surpass AngioVac in sales as it targets a larger market opportunity estimated at $3 billion in the U.S. [49] Product Development and Future Growth - The NanoKnife technology is positioned as a focal therapy option for prostate cancer, targeting the intermediate-risk patient segment [78] - The company is exploring opportunities in ben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) and aims to expand its product offerings in this area [95] - Ongoing R&D initiatives include potential new devices for deep vein thrombosis (DVT) treatment, leveraging existing technologies [97] Market Challenges and Opportunities - The company faces challenges in securing consistent payment structures for its products, particularly for NanoKnife, which requires ongoing education and awareness efforts [90] - The competitive landscape is evolving, with AngioDynamics focusing on gaining market share from established players while also developing new customer bases [73] Investor Communication - The CEO expressed frustration over the stock's performance relative to the company's achievements, emphasizing the commitment to transparency and delivering on promises made to investors [102] Additional Insights - The company is actively expanding its sales force to support growth in the PE market, with plans to increase from 60 to potentially 100 sales representatives [61] - The CEO highlighted the importance of clinical data and physician confidence in driving product adoption and market penetration [70] This summary encapsulates the key insights and strategic direction of AngioDynamics as discussed in the conference call, providing a comprehensive overview of the company's current status and future outlook.

AngioDynamics J.P. Morgan Conference: MedTech Growth Push, Cash-Flow Path, CEO Retirement Plan
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-15 00:04
Core Insights - AngioDynamics is experiencing significant growth in its MedTech portfolio, particularly with the Auryon platform, which has generated over $60 million in revenue this year, up from zero at launch in September 2020 [1][4] - The company is transitioning from a legacy interventional radiology focus to a more science-driven MedTech portfolio, targeting larger and faster-growing markets [2][3] - CEO Jim Clemmer plans to retire later this year but will remain involved as a major shareholder and advisor during the leadership transition [4][17] Product and Market Developments - Auryon, a laser-based atherectomy platform, has seen nearly 20% growth year-to-date, with increased traction in hospitals and higher average selling prices [5] - The AlphaVac system, targeting pulmonary embolism, is positioned as a differentiated product in the VTE market, which is still early in its penetration curve, with only about 15% market penetration [6][7] - NanoKnife, used for treating intermediate-risk prostate cancer, has received an on-label indication and is expected to expand into ben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) [8][9][16] Financial Performance and Projections - AngioDynamics is debt-free with positive adjusted EBITDA and expects to be cash-flow positive by fiscal 2026, with MedTech products projected to exceed 50% of revenue by fiscal 2027 [4][11][14] - The company's MedTech products have achieved a 25% compound annual growth rate over the past five years, with continued growth anticipated [10][11] - Management plans to optimize the portfolio further as MedTech becomes a larger share of the business, with no substantial M&A expected in the near term [13][14] Leadership Transition - The company will conduct a deliberate search for a new CEO, considering both internal and external candidates, with no rush to finalize the appointment [17][18] - Clemmer's retirement is based on personal circumstances, and he feels confident in the company's recent execution and results [17][18]

AngioDynamics (ANGO) Q1 2026 Earnings Transcript
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-06 17:45
Core Insights - AngioDynamics reported a strong performance in the first quarter of fiscal year 2026, with a revenue increase of 12.2% to $75.7 million, driven by growth in both Med Tech and Med Device segments [15][4][5] - The Med Tech segment saw significant growth of 26.1%, while the Med Device segment grew by 2.3% [15][16] - The company is focused on strategic transformation, emphasizing profitability alongside revenue growth, and plans to continue investing in product development and regulatory opportunities [4][5][28] Financial Performance - Total revenue for Q1 FY 2026 was $75.7 million, a 12.2% increase compared to the same quarter in FY 2025 [15] - Med Tech revenue reached $35.3 million, reflecting a 26.1% year-over-year growth, while Med Device revenue was $40.4 million, up 2.3% [15][16] - Gross margin improved to 55.3%, a 90-basis-point increase from the previous year, driven by pricing initiatives and a favorable sales mix [19][20] Segment Highlights - The Auryon platform generated $16.5 million in revenue, growing 20.1% year-over-year, marking 17 consecutive quarters of double-digit growth [17] - Mechanical Thrombectomy revenue, including AngioVac and AlphaVac, increased by 41.2% year-over-year, totaling $11.3 million [18] - NanoKnife revenue was $6.4 million, a 26.7% increase, with expectations for continued growth driven by increased adoption in prostate cancer treatment [10][18] Strategic Initiatives - The company is expanding its sales force for Mechanical Thrombectomy, increasing dedicated sales representatives from 40 to 50 to support growth [39] - AngioDynamics is focused on enhancing its product portfolio and market penetration, particularly in the hospital sector, to drive future growth [6][9] - The company plans to maintain a strong emphasis on research and development, targeting approximately 10% of sales for R&D initiatives [21] Guidance and Outlook - AngioDynamics raised its fiscal year 2026 net sales guidance to a range of $308 million to $313 million, reflecting growth of 5% to 7% over the previous year [24][25] - The company expects Med Tech net sales to grow 14% to 16%, while Med Device sales are anticipated to remain flat [26] - Adjusted EBITDA is projected to be between $6 million and $10 million, an increase from prior guidance [27]
AngioDynamics (ANGO) Q3 2025 Earnings Transcript
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-06 17:42
Core Insights - AngioDynamics reported strong financial performance for the third quarter of fiscal year 2025, with total worldwide revenue reaching $72 million, reflecting a year-over-year growth of over 9% [5][18]. - The company has increased its guidance for total revenue, MedTech growth, gross margin, adjusted EBITDA, and adjusted EPS for the fiscal year 2025, indicating confidence in its operational strategy and market position [6][30]. Financial Performance - Total revenue for the third quarter was $72 million, with MedTech segment revenue growing by 22% to $31.3 million, while the Med Device segment saw a slight increase of 0.9% to $40.7 million [5][18]. - Adjusted EBITDA was reported at $1.3 million, a significant improvement from a loss of $3.6 million in the prior year [25]. - The adjusted net loss was $3.1 million, or an adjusted loss per share of $0.08, improving from a loss of $6.5 million or $0.16 per share in the same quarter last year [24]. Product Performance - The Auryon platform generated $13.9 million in revenue, growing 17.3% year-over-year, marking 15 consecutive quarters of double-digit growth [18]. - Mechanical Thrombectomy revenue, including AlphaVac and AngioVac, increased by 46.7% year-over-year, with AlphaVac revenue soaring by 161.4% [19]. - NanoKnife revenue reached $6.3 million, a 5.3% increase, with disposable revenue growing by 16.2% [19]. Strategic Outlook - The company expects revenue for fiscal 2025 to be in the range of $285 million to $288 million, representing growth of 5.3% to 6.4% over fiscal year 2024 [29]. - MedTech net sales are projected to grow between 14% to 16%, while Med Device net sales are expected to remain flat [30]. - The company is focused on increasing penetration in the hospital market for Auryon and expanding its sales force for AlphaVac and AngioVac to drive further growth [32][47]. Research and Development - R&D expenses were $6.9 million, or 9.6% of sales, down from $8.1 million or 12.2% of sales a year ago, reflecting a commitment to long-term growth in the MedTech segment [23]. - The AMBITION BTK trial is set to evaluate clinical outcomes for Auryon, with enrollment expected to begin in the next quarter [53]. Market Position - The company is well-positioned with a strong balance sheet, reporting $44.8 million in cash and cash equivalents as of February 28, 2025 [25]. - AngioDynamics is focused on driving sustainable, profitable growth through its innovative product portfolio and strategic market initiatives [35][58].
